基于偏振度的偏振模色散补偿中检测信号对不同归零码型的响应研究
The Research of Response of Checking Signals to Different Return-zero Formats in the PMD Compensation Systems Based on Degree of Polarization
光纤通信 偏振模色散 偏振度 调制码型 Optical fiber communication Polarization mode dispersion Degree of polarization Modulation format
摘要
从理论上数值分析和比较了一阶和二阶偏振模色散对各种光调制码型(RZ、CSRZ、RZDPSK、CSRZ-DPSK)的偏振模色散的影响,结果表明:不同码型的偏振度大不相同,RZ码受偏振度影响最大,CSRZ-DPSK码受二阶偏振模色散的影响最小,在补偿系统中更适合缓解偏振模色散.
Abstract
In the polarization mode dispersion(PMD) compensation experiment,the degree of polarization (DOP) is used as the most common feedback signal,which reflects PMD and its influence on the transmission system factually. The influences of first-order and second-order PMD on DOP of four optical modulation formats(RZ,CSRZ,RZ-DPSK and CSRZ-DPSK) are compared and mathematically analyzed.The result shows that different formats have different DOP and the second-order PMD has less influence on DOP of CSRZ-DPSK format,which is fitter for mitigating PMD than the other formats in self-adaptive PMD compensation system.
